My Business

My business is a rent house, i have twelve room house and i rent ksh 2,500 per room.This business is good and profitable and am now in the middle of building another six room house.This is a good business as its a long lasting business. I live in the Mombasa county where there are so many people so i get tenants coming looking for rooms so i alway have cutomers. In a month i get an income of ksh 30,000. Risks in this business includes, when a tenant leaves without paying rent. With the income i get from this business i use ksh 5,000 for my family food,ksh 10,000 for school fees and ksh 5,000 is for my family's other expenditures.So i save ksh 10,000 per month. With this amount i can repay my zidisha loan if granted.

Loan Proposal

Hello, am so glad to have reached this far, My thanks to the entire zidisha team for the hard work done in my application.With this loan i want to finish my rent house which is in its final stage. So with this loan i will buy plyboards worth ksh 25,000, ceiling nails worth ksh 1,000 and i will use ksh 5,000 for lourbor charge. So with this house i will have added value to the business and i expect more income to my business.
